  • Meiny Prins unveils the revolutionary, plant-controlled concept Priva TopCrop at the Horti Fair

De Lier  01 November 201104:34

On the first day of the Horti Fair Meiny Prins unveiled the Priva TopCrop concept, a revolutionary, plant-controlled concept for process control. The Priva TopCrop concept was introduced on Priva's stand (11.06.04) amid wide interest.

"After three years of intensive development we have succeeded in actually including the plant in the control process. This will give growers and crop consultants a new 'control' for influencing the crop activity and the suppression of diseases. Using Priva TopCrop the grower can exercise more targeted control to improve his/her operating efficiency.

A large sheet was drawn back to reveal a special, 'talking plant'. "This special plant makes its own decisions on how to have the irrigation, heating and ventilation", Meiny Prins continued. "Using various infographics, LED lights and a smoke generator the plant makes clear how it is feeling and shows what needs to be done to keep crop activity and disease suppression optimal".

The new concept comprises the existing Priva Connext controls for the greenhouse climate, along with an additional control that provides irrigation, heating and ventilation whenever the plant demands it. The systems' base and starting point is plant activity. This is measured via the plants' water balance, in other words: from the take-up, the transportation and the transpiration of water. The purpose of the control is to ensure that the plant always has enough water to transport nutrients and assimilates, to build new fibres and to keep itself cool. The crop control promotes a more balanced crop growth, without growth disorders or abnormalities. This can be achieved by inhibiting the transpiration or by giving the plant additional stimulus. Transpiration is, after all, the driving force behind the take-up of water and nutrients.

In the next couple of months, various practical tests will be accomplished to determine the added value for most common crop varieties. The actual product introduction is planned for 2012.

About Priva
Priva develops and supplies products and services for sustainable, renewable climate control and process management. Its products and services are sold and used in more than one hundred countries. Priva's customers are active in horticulture, commercial buildings and industry. In the horticultural sector, Priva is the global leader for climate control. Water recycling and water savings are spearheads for the company based in the Westland.
